We would NOT want to allow users to create public templates so I would hope that it would still be possible to prevent non admin users from doing this.

Our reasoning is that everybody sees the list of public templates the value of public templates are diminished if there is a really long list of ill thought out examples. If this is the case, people will ignore all public offerings.

We've introduced a transfer ownership of template facility to aid template sharing. We're running a really old version of evals and I don't think we've had the resources to contribute this patch back yet.

I have fixed in my local Evalsys what I think it's a bug, but it seems that it could be a feature. I would be very grateful if somebody could clarify this to me.

In Admin settings, template's visibility can be configured to be public, private (only visible by template's owner) or configurable by owner. 
This third case is what I have been testing and it doesn't work, as users can't change visibility in their templates. Only admin user can edit templates and set them as private or public.

This behaviour is in the code at ModifyTemplateProducer.java (1) and EvalAuthoringServiceImpl.java (2). Current user is verified to be admin user and in any other case, template's visibility can not be changed.

We think that this is a bug so I have fixed it removing the admin user verification. Instead of this, I verify that current user is template's owner to allow the visibility change.

My changes cause a fail in Evalsys tests (3), as admin user is specifically tested to be the only one that can change visibility in templates.

Please, could you tell me if I am missing something here? I think that template's owner should be able to set this and I have a patch to change this if you agree with me.
